[PATCH v3 1/2] powerpc/mce: Avoid using irq_work_queue() in realmode

Ganesh ganeshgr at linux.ibm.com
Mon Jan 17 19:09:26 AEDT 2022


On 11/24/21 18:33, Nicholas Piggin wrote:

> Excerpts from Ganesh Goudar's message of November 24, 2021 7:54 pm:
>> In realmode mce handler we use irq_work_queue() to defer
>> the processing of mce events, irq_work_queue() can only
>> be called when translation is enabled because it touches
>> memory outside RMA, hence we enable translation before
>> calling irq_work_queue and disable on return, though it
>> is not safe to do in realmode.
>>
>> To avoid this, program the decrementer and call the event
>> processing functions from timer handler.

> The problem with a counter is that you're clearing the irq work pending
> in the timer interrupt, so you'll never call in here again to clear that
> (until something else sets irq work).
>
> But as far as I can see it does not need to be a counter, just a flag.
> The machine check calls will process multiple events, right? (and the
> current irq_work queue does not queue the same work multiple times).

You are right, It can just be a flag.

>
> Oh. That's actually bad, isn't it? Our irq work should be per-CPU
> because the callbacks are mainly only operating on the local paca
> queued events, so we have a longstanding bug there AFAIKS. Your patch
> will solve it if everything is converted over.
>
